Weld Foremen

Role

A Weld Foreman is responsible for the direct supervision of welding crews, assigning daily tasks based on project priorities and individual welder strengths. They ensure all work meets code requirements and dimensional tolerances while maintaining a safe, organized, and efficient work environment. This role bridges the gap between high-level production goals and hands-on technical execution.

Key Responsibilities

  • Crew Supervision: Lead and coordinate the daily activities of the welding team, providing clear direction on work assignments and production goals.
  • Technical Guidance: Provide hands-on assistance and troubleshooting for welding procedures (MIG, TIG, Stick) to ensure proper penetration and structural integrity.
  • Quality Inspections: Conduct regular audits of finished welds to verify adherence to blueprint tolerances and material specification codes.
  • Workflow Management: Monitor production schedules and manage the flow of materials to prevent bottlenecks and ensure deadlines are met.
  • Safety Enforcement: Champion shop safety by enforcing PPE requirements, proper equipment usage, and clean workstation protocols.
  • Equipment Maintenance: Oversee the daily operation and basic maintenance of welding machines, grinders, and material handling equipment like jib cranes.

Expectations

A Weld Foreman must be a decisive leader who maintains high standards under pressure and adapts quickly to shifting production priorities. You should be a self-directed, detail-oriented mentor with the ability to anticipate and prevent shop-floor bottlenecks. Success in this role requires a balance of technical mastery and the communication skills necessary to manage a diverse team with minimal oversight.
